1.This E Commerce website is all about players buying products from other players.
2.Anyone can sell a product or multiple products across multiple games once verified.
3.There are multiple games to buy and sell from.
3.Your first time buy will require a verification process; yes this is annoying, but ensures that nobody is posing as someone else. It also protects the buyer as well.
4.The buyer's money spent is also protected after making a purchase until the seller has delivered the product and both buyer and seller verify a full delivery of the product.
Buyer's money is protected via escrow, so seller won't get until product is
delivered and confirmed delivery.

The previous payment would have not really worked because the aim of this verification is to establish the person and his/her ownership of the payment account being used, but we can only find out during verification so Perry still continued to ask for the documents. So if there are 2 names/persons involved with a payment, our system/staff construes it as unauthorized payment use. We've had cases where payments had to be prematurely canceled due to retractions made by parents who've had kids using their cards without their permission, or partners for the same reason. This is despite the fact that the person's identity in the documents we receive is the payment account holder; the fact that it's different from the PlayerAuctions account holder is still an ambiguous fact regardless if the PA account holder was somehow able to get the payment account holder's pictures and documents.
When this happens, sellers who truthfully deliver have their payment aborted.

Everyone knows that if you buy gold online, there is a huge possibility your account will get hacked or you will get scammed. Using PlayerAuctions as a third party middle-man takes away the risk. They take your money, hold it in limbo until your order is confirmed delivered by both parties. Then the funds are released to the seller (minus a small commission). If there is a dispute, you can raise it with PlayerAuctions and they will investigate and the burden of proof is on the seller to verify a disputed delivery. If they can not, or if the delivery was to the wrong person, they will refund your money to you and nothing lost except the time it took for them to investigate. As a buyer, your payment is secure with us and will not be released to the seller until you click confirm on our website, once you have decided that the item/gold/account that you bought is good and complete. If you find any problems with the sale, you may dispute it and if the sale you received is not as described, you will be issued a refund. As a seller, your payment will be released once buyer is satisfied with the sale, and this guarantees that you will receive payment as opposed to transacting blindly on the internet with someone you don't know. In the case of disputes, if you've proven that you were able to deliver the sale successfully and as described, you will get the payment. Please note that we enact the User Assumption of Risk as stated in the front page of our website, in that we cannot guarantee that all trades will be free from risks. However, by carefully securing your order and being wary of scamming attempts, together with our team's efforts to secure an order, this can be thoroughly mitigated. The verification process is our standard anti-fraud security measure. Especially in your case, our system logged 2 different real names on the account so we had to verify you. The order was canceled by you, not us - just to clarify. On your ticket, you asked where's your refund, to which our agent already replied:
"Thank you for your email regarding refund time. Refunds are typically processed within 1-2 business days; however, in rare cases it can take up to 5 business days for your account to receive the funds."
As for the charge, this amount of money is only put on reserved status and is not received by merchants yet (in this case, us, PlayerAuctions). We can only receive the money if the purchase was authorized and only after 7+ business days. We are not the ones who will refund you but your payment processor, since they need to reverse the funds and authorize it back to your account.
You do not have to "fight back" for your money. Refunds are automatically done by banks and payment processors.
